Student will demonstrate mastery and growth in content knowledge at challenging levels of complexity necessary to create, collaborate, think critically, and solve problems. Students will achieve reasonable progress as demonstrated through multiple measures, including annual state and district assessments based on the following disciplines:
A minimum of 90% of K-3 students will score mid/above grade level Benchmark on EOY DIBELS 8.
A minimum of 70% of 3-8 students will meet or exceed expectations on CMAS English Language Arts.
A minimum of 70% of students will meet or exceed expectations on PSAT/SAT Reading & Writing.
A minimum of 60% of Multilingual Learners in grades will meet on-track growth targets for the WIDA ACCESS English Language Proficiency assessment.
The benchmarking districts included in the charts and graphs below are defined as Colorado districts with student enrollments ranging from 3,500-10,000 and Free or Reduced-Price Lunch Eligibility rates between 34% and 50%.Â
